THE only thing that can be said with certainty about Wednesday’s Budget is it promises to be the most difficult day of Finance Minister Charlie McCreevy’s ministry as he faces the reality of borrowing money to balance the books.

Having been criticised, and rightly so, for mismanaging the economy when times were good, the major challenge facing Mr McCreevy is to bring expenditure back on track. Spending on public services spiralled out of control in a cynical vote-buying spree before the May general election.

While global retrenchment can be blamed for a slowdown in the economy, the government must carry the can for squandering the largesse of the Celtic Tiger era, heavily contributing to the aura of doom and gloom now engulfing the country.
